Local experiences and cultural flavor

Sardinia’s coast is celebrated for its culinary traditions, and Platamona is no exception. Try a seafood-centric menu featuring grilled fish, bottarga (dried fish roe), fregola with seafood, and culurgiones—the beloved Sardinian stuffed pasta. Local markets in Sassari and nearby towns are great places to buy fresh produce, artisanal bread, and cheeses to enjoy in your vacation rental’s kitchen. If you’re staying in a cabin with a grill, a sunset barbecue featuring local sausages and bread carasau can be a memorable evening.

In the broader Sassari province, you’ll find historic churches, ancient ruins, and open-air museums that reveal the layers of Sardinia’s history. Day trips and nearby gems worth exploring

Platamona is a great launchpad for day trips to some of Sardinia’s most intriguing towns. A short drive can bring you to Sassari’s historic center, where you’ll discover medieval churches, the Angel’s Cemetery, and a bustling university vibe with cafés and boutiques. From Sassari, you can venture to Alghero, a Lucerne-like coastal town known for its Catalan-influenced old town, city walls, and vibrant seafood scene. Porto Torres offers Roman-era ruins and a pleasant marina, while nearby Stintino is famous for its ribbon of beaches and access to the sea’s crystal-clear waters.

If you’re craving a more dramatic natural experience, plan a day trip to the Asinara Island National Park, reachable by ferry from nearby ports. The island’s wild landscapes, imposing blue waters, and charming former quarantine towns provide a contrast to Platamona’s calm beaches and are ideal for a guided boat tour or a half-day hike.

Seasonal rhythm: when to visit Platamona

The best time to enjoy Platamona’s beaches and outdoor life is during late spring through early autumn. May through September offers long sunny days, warm water, and plentiful beach amenities. If you prefer milder temperatures for hiking and exploring towns inland, late spring (April–June) and early autumn (September–October) are excellent options with fewer crowds and a more relaxed pace.

Practical tips for planning your Platamona stay

Getting to Platamona is straightforward. If you fly into Sardinia, you’ll likely land at Olbia or Alghero airports, then drive or take a transfer to the coast. From Sassari, Platamona can be reached by a short coastal drive or a scenic bus route. Having a car is convenient for exploring the coastline, visiting inland towns, and accessing day trips to Alghero, Sassari, and Porto Torres.
